NettetThis coin represents the earliest attempt by an English monarch to issue a groat, struck at 89 grains as part of a major re-coinage from 1279. It was not well received, with many being used as jewelry, and a successful groat coinage would not be introduced until the reign of Edward III. Nettet25. mar. 2008 · The crown is the most common coin in circulation. Worth 5 shillings, it is issued in both gold and silver. The crown is also equal to a Venetian ducat, a Flemish gelder, or a French êcu (sometimes called a French crown). Half-a-crown is worth 2 shillings 6 pence (sometimes expressed as "2 and 6"). Wish I'd bought more in … NettetThe Farthing (¼d) coin from "fourthing," was worth one quarter of a Penny. It was minted in Bronze and replaced the earlier Copper Farthing s, it was used during the reign of six monarchs: Victoria, Edward VII, George V, Edward VIII, George VI and Elizabeth II, ceasing to be legal tender in 1960.
